Biffle Looking for Kansas Win No. 3

Biffle has 19 Sprint Cup Series starts at Kansas, earning two wins, seven top-five and nine top-10 finishes. Biffle has led a total of 346 laps at Kansas and also has an average finish of 11.3 at the 1.5-mile track, statistically making this track his best for finishes.
